Dimensions: Approximately 8.5 cm (H) x 6 cm (W)

Wheel-thrown in a rich iron stoneware, this pot was reduction-fired for fourteen hours to 1290ºC in my self-built gas kiln. Its satin finish comes from a wood-ash glaze whose colour naturally varies with the melt. The glaze breaks and pools across the faceted surface, showing deeper blue tones where it gathers into glass and a soft satin yellow-green on the lighter areas, where iron flecks in the clay body create a freckled effect.

Fired hot enough to fully vitrify, the clay body is now completely watertight. While highly durable, the edges can still chip if handled roughly, so care is advised.
